what kinds of health/societal/environmental issues go along with stoves?
one third of the world’s population cook over a open flame
open fires produce a lot of smoke
approximately 1.4 million people die per year from disease related to indoor air pollution (3 people per second)

the lifestyle of a typical Nicaraguan family
men are often not in the house, women are responsible for all of the cooking as well as childcare in 5-6 person families
families are usually very poor ($1/day) and have no access to electricity
they currently cook over wood fires, but the wood is running out
there is very little access to alternate fuel sources except waste rice husks

not everthing is perfect
BATCH CONTINUOUS
this design needs a battery to operate. most people in nicaragua cannot afford batteries
approximately every 30 minutes, the flame goes out. therefore the batch needs to be dumped every 30 minutes
this design requires constant tapping to produce an even flame throughout the cook time. the flame is also relatively unstable
constant refilling is required approximately every 5 minutes to keep an even flame. the char also needs to be removed during this time span
